Taapsee Pannu reunites with Anubhav Sinha as Assi trailer promises a gripping courtroom drama

The official trailer of Assi was unveiled on Tuesday, giving audiences a chilling glimpse into a story rooted in harsh realities. The film brings Taapsee Pannu back together with director Anubhav Sinha after their acclaimed collaborations in Mulk and Thappad. Known for addressing socially relevant themes, the duo once again explores a subject that reflects headlines often seen but rarely confronted.

The trailer opens on an unsettling note, introducing a brutal rape case that captures nationwide attention. Taapsee plays a determined lawyer who steps in to represent the survivor, fully aware of the resistance and hostility that lie ahead. Her character is shown navigating a tense investigation and emotionally charged courtroom hearings, refusing to back down despite repeated attempts to silence her.

Kani Kusruti and Mohammed Zeeshan Ayyub appear as a couple whose lives are torn apart after a horrific assault leaves the woman traumatised and abandoned near railway tracks. One striking moment shows ink being thrown at Taapsee’s face inside the courtroom, a scene that underlines the social and institutional challenges faced by those who fight for justice.

The trailer has sparked strong reactions on social media, with viewers calling the film important and timely. Speaking about the project, Anubhav Sinha said the story emerged from everyday news that often fades from public memory. Taapsee added that Assi seeks to remind audiences that such crimes should never be normalised and that collective responsibility goes beyond reading headlines.
